About Willow Springs Golf Course

Willow Springs Golf Course is an 18-hole, par 62 links-style course located in West Friendship, MD. Designed by architect Al Janis, the course offers a Scottish 'feel' with mounding, deep greenside bunkering, and 'love grass' surrounding nearly every hole. In summary

Willow Springs Golf Course has received praise for its improved course conditions, particularly the greens and fairways, and is noted for being a good value for practicing short game. The staff is often described as friendly, and the course offers a scenic layout with a relaxed atmosphere. However, some visitors have raised concerns about inconsistent maintenance, including issues with the driving range and tee boxes, as well as occasional slow pace of play and increased pricing.
